Retirees Covered by Class Action

The County received the Court’s Order Granting Final Approval of the class action Settlement Agreement between Sonoma County Association of Retirees, et. al. v. Sonoma County, CV 09-4432 CW on April 18, 2017. See the Final Court Judgment for additional details.  Additional information regarding the settlement can be found on the SCARE website at: http://www.sonomacountyretirees.com/legal.shtml

Employees hired before January 1, 2009 and who are still actively employed, and recent retirees who retired on or after July 1, 2016 are not impacted by this class action Settlement Agreement. 

Retiree medical benefits are governed by the Salary Resolution.  Memorandum of Understanding (MOU) may contain specific agreements related to retiree medical benefits, and these agreements are for a defined contract period.

Health Reimbursement Arrangement (SCARE-HRA)

The Sonoma County Association of Retired Employees Health Reimbursement Arrangement (SCARE-HRA) has been established pursuant to the Settlement Agreement in the lawsuit entitled Sonoma County Association of Retirees, et. al. v. Sonoma County, CV 09-4432 CW. Only members of the Settlement Class in this lawsuit are eligible for the benefits of the SCARE-HRA.

County contributions, totaling approximately $12 million, will be paid in three (3) increments on or before the following dates: June 30, 2017, June 30, 2018, and June 30, 2019.  The County contributions to individual SCARE-HRA participant accounts will be made on a pro rata basis and will be based on the number of surviving participants. County contribution amounts in 2017, 2018 and 2019 will be determined annually; amount of the contribution will vary each year.
